.footer__main-section{display:flex;flex-direction:column;gap:2rem;padding:2rem 0}@media screen and (min-width: 990px){.footer__main-section{flex-direction:row;gap:4rem}}.footer__logo-column{display:flex;justify-content:center;align-items:flex-start}@media screen and (min-width: 990px){.footer__logo-column{width:33.333%;justify-content:center;align-items:center}}.footer__logo-wrapper{max-width:200px}.footer__logo-wrapper img{width:100%;height:auto}.footer__links-column{width:100%}@media screen and (min-width: 990px){.footer__links-column{width:66.666%}}.footer__links-grid{display:flex;flex-direction:column;gap:0}@media screen and (min-width: 990px){.footer__links-grid{display:grid;grid-template-columns:1fr 1fr;gap:1rem}}.footer__section{display:none}@media screen and (min-width: 990px){.footer__section{display:block}}.footer__section-title{font-size:1.4rem;font-weight:600;margin-bottom:1.5rem;text-transform:uppercase;letter-spacing:.05em}.footer__section-list{list-style:none;padding:0;margin:0}.footer__section-list li{margin-bottom:.8rem}.footer__section-list a,.footer__section-list span{color:rgba(var(--color-foreground),.75);text-decoration:none;font-size:1.4rem;transition:color .2s ease}.footer__section-list a:hover{color:rgb(var(--color-foreground))}.footer__accordion-wrapper{display:block}@media screen and (min-width: 990px){.footer__accordion-wrapper{display:none}}.footer__accordion{border-top:.1rem solid rgba(var(--color-foreground),.3)}.footer__accordion summary{display:flex;justify-content:space-between;align-items:center;padding:1.5rem 0;cursor:pointer;list-style:none}.footer__accordion summary::-webkit-details-marker{display:none}.footer__accordion .summary__title{font-size:1.4rem;font-weight:600;text-transform:uppercase;letter-spacing:.05em}.footer__accordion .icon-caret{width:1rem;height:1rem;transition:transform .3s ease}.footer__accordion details[open]>summary .icon-caret{transform:rotate(180deg)}.footer__accordion .accordion__content-wrapper{display:grid;grid-template-rows:0fr;transition:grid-template-rows .3s ease}.footer__accordion details[open]>.accordion__content-wrapper{grid-template-rows:1fr}.footer__accordion details.closing>.accordion__content-wrapper{grid-template-rows:0fr}.footer__accordion .accordion__content-inner{overflow:hidden}.footer__accordion .accordion__content{padding-bottom:1.5rem}.footer__divider{border:none;border-top:.1rem solid rgba(var(--color-foreground),.15);margin:0;width:100%}.footer__bottom-section{display:flex;flex-direction:column;align-items:center;gap:0;padding-top:1em;text-align:center}@media screen and (min-width: 990px){.footer__bottom-section{flex-direction:row;justify-content:space-between;align-items:center;padding:0;text-align:left}}.list-social__link .svg-wrapper{height:3rem;width:3rem}.footer__copyright{font-size:1.5rem;color:rgba(var(--color-foreground),.75)}.footer__copyright a{color:inherit;text-decoration:none;transition:color .2s ease}.footer__copyright a:hover{color:rgb(var(--color-foreground))}.footer__social{display:flex;justify-content:center}@media screen and (min-width: 990px){.footer__social{justify-content:flex-end}}.footer__social .list-social{gap:1.5rem}
/*# sourceMappingURL=/cdn/shop/t/5/assets/footer-custom.css.map */
